When you say that you're young what do you mean, really? Is it because you're a certain age or you find yourself in a certain circle in your community? All these and more can be somewhat valid reasons why we consider ourselves to be young. However, I like to think of being young in terms of not just a stage but an experience- the youth experience. An experience of unhindered openness and growth where we learn deeply, love freely and live passionately. This requires some level of curiosity and courage to peep beneath the surface of everyday life situations and to innovate.

I believe that youth is an energy that surges through our beings and beckons us to summon our divine gifts and talents for manifestation on the grand stage of life. You are blessed to be young- really. And you can be young for as long as you choose to. Yes, along with old age may come a few wrinkles here and there but your soul knows no wrinkle. You can be forever young! Explore with us in this issue- learn, have fun and have lots of fun.
